Frethey House Care Home offers residential and nursing care, including trial stays, short stays, convalescent care and long-term care for individuals or couples. The home is a beautiful Victorian building that has been skillfully converted into a friendly and safe care environment for older people, set within two acres of gardens and beautiful rolling countryside.

The home has retained a number of period features and is set within attractive and peaceful gardens in an accessible location with stunning views over the surrounding countryside.

The home welcomes permanent and respite residents, employing a multidisciplinary approach that cares for both the mental and physical health and wellbeing of residents.

Frethey House Care Home is a welcoming, friendly and safe care home which respects the privacy and dignity of residents at all times. Privacy is always respected and personal choice is encouraged, whether within the home itself or as part of community pursuits.

After having two strokes and some rehabilitation, my father lived in Frethey House Care Home from the summer of 2016 until May 2017.
I travelled a long distance to visit him at weekends, visiting was a pleasure, Frethey House is conveniently located close to the M5 motorway and Taunton Hospital.
The
buildings and gardens are well maintained, the surrounding countryside is pleasant and parking spaces always available.
The security is good, partly because the care home is located down a country lane, further, there is a pin code used to enter the building.
The management and nursing staff were very friendly, cheerful and patiently guided the family through both major and minor decisions relating to my father's care. I felt that without exception, the staff had my father's best interests at heart.
The nurses managed feeding via a PEG tube, they had this down to a fine art, in order to avoid aspiration of vomit into the lungs, this kept my father out of the hospital for protracted periods.
The staff went out of their way to make me feel welcome during visits.
In summary, I warmly recommend Frethey House Care Home.

My brother was admitted to Frethey House on 31st May 2016 and had to receive complex care due to Dysphagia following a second stroke in hospital. He subsequently had to be fed via a G-peg tube and suffered aspiration pneumonia a number of times as a result. The staff at Frethey House responded rapidly
to these unfortunate episodes and due to their care and diligence enabled my brother to survive for a year. I cannot recommend them enough for the kindness and dignity afforded to him when there was little hope of recovery.
